Women in the Footsteps of the Buddha
Discover the profound journeys of female practitioners in the Buddhist tradition with "Women in the Footsteps of the Buddha" by Taylor & Francis Ltd. Published in 1998, this hardback edition spans 204 pages and delves into the historical and spiritual quest for liberation undertaken by early bhikkunis. This essential text offers a unique perspective, being one of the few works in the Buddhist canon authored by women. It illuminates their challenges, insights, and contributions, highlighting the invaluable role women have played in shaping Buddhist thought and practice.
